Clyde Lovellette was the first basketball player in history to win an NCAA Championship, an Olympic gold medal and an NBA Championship. He captured his NCAA title with Kansas in 1952.

John Thompson won an NBA title as a player with the Celtics in 1965-66 and then coached the NCAA champs Georgetown in 1984. Larry Brown won an ABA title in 1969 as a player with the Oakland Oaks and was the coach of the NCAA champs Kansas in 1988.Christian Braun won an NCAA title with the Jayhawks.
